Departing from Québec City by bus, embark on an unforgettable journey through time with this Cruise and Visit of Grosse-Île. Immerse yourself in the captivating history of Grosse-Île, a pivotal immigration station from 1832 to 1937. This excursion seamlessly combines a scenic cruise on the St. Lawrence River with an immersive guided tour of the island's rich heritage.

Discover the Island with Expert Guides
Once ashore, Parks Canada guides lead you through preserved buildings, sweeping landscapes, and immersive exhibits that bring the immigrant experience to life. Visit iconic landmarks such as the quarantine station, the Celtic Cross, and the Irish Memorial.
